Product Description

Bosch Rexroth’s IndraDyn S group of synchronous motors are marked by their distinct product advantages. These include a compact construction, highly precise encoder systems, and high torque density. The MSK motors are a family of motors in this group commonly used as rotary main and servo drive motors.

The MSK071D-0450-NN-S1-UG0-NSNN is an MSK servo motor model on the IndraDrive platform from Bosch Rexroth. It is a self-cooling motor whose heat dissipation mechanism is natural convection. Equipped with a temperature sensor of the KTY84 type in its stator, it is protected from damage due to thermal overload. This temperature sensor works with a temperature model that operates independently of the sensor. There is a single-turn encoder in this motor that uses the optical measuring method for position detection. It has an Hiperface interface and permits the recording of the absolute, indirect position within one mechanical motor rotation. This encoder has a system accuracy of ±80 angular seconds and a data memory where the motor’s parameters are stored.

A maximum torque of 66.0Nm can be generated by the MSK071D-0450-NN-S1-UG0-NSNN, and it can attain a maximum speed of 6,000 revolutions per minute. It has four pole pairs and a rotor with a moment of inertia of 0.00255 kgm2. According to IEC 60529, the Ingress Protection rating of this motor is IP 65. This means that it is touch-proof, dust-proof, and impermeable to sprays from water jets. Its output shaft is the plain type, and it has a shaft sealing ring that prevents liquids from entering the motor through its shaft. This shaft also ensures a non-positive shaft-hub connection with zero-backlash and promotes the motor’s quiet operation.

MSK071D-0450-NN-S1-UG0-NSNN Technical Specifications

Continuous Current at Standstill 100 K: 17.6 A
Continuous Torque at Standstill 100 K: 20.0 Nm
Maximum Current: 69.3 A
Maximum Torque: 66.0 Nm
Winding Inductivity: 3,200 mH
